Welcome to the Fanout Relay team at Corvastra. Our main pain point is backpressure: when the Pulsegram notification service falls behind, the relay buffers events in Redis and sheds low-priority traffic first. For this week's eng sync, please pull live queue-depth metrics from the internal throttle dashboard. Authenticating against that dashboard's API requires the credential that follows.

app token of badug-tahaf = qvz11-nP5FBNr8qnh

## Deployment

The Marloft retention sweeper runs as a sidecar to the main Brindlehale API pod. Deploy it only after the archive bucket exists and the audit exporter is healthy; otherwise deletions proceed without a recoverable copy. Verify dry-run output before enabling destructive mode. The sweeper reads the values shown below at startup.

config for kafof-bawef:
holath:
  log_level: debug
  metrics_host: metrics.holath.qorvelsys.internal
  pin: 2191
  pool_size: 32

## Configuration

Brambleset sits in front of the Kestrelstore KV cluster and rejects lookups for absent keys. Tune BLOOM_BITS and BLOOM_HASHES per the sizing table; defaults suit ~10M keys at 1% false positives. All settings live in .env at the service root. The Kestrelstore admin credential must appear on the following line.

env line for fafof-fahag: LEDGER_TOKEN5=f8790

Subject: Graphlet cut-over — done

Team,

Cut-over to Graphlet v2 finished Tuesday night. The old Mapvine visualizer is read-only until end of month, then retired. All dependency graphs re-rendered without loss; two orphaned edges were pruned manually. Nightly sync jobs now point at the new renderer. One follow-up: legacy bookmarks need redirects, tracked separately. The production instance now runs with these settings:

settings of bafof-fajog:
[aldix]
port = 9300
region = north-3
host = aldix.kelvilabs.example
team = istath
timeout_ms = 1500
retries = 8